Keep Your Calendar Up-To-Date

A VA can help you keep your calendar up-to-date by adding new appointments, reminders, and deadlines as needed. They can also help you plan ahead by blocking off time for important projects or tasks that require concentrated effort. This way, you can avoid double-booking yourself or forgetting important deadlines.

Schedule Meetings and Appointments

VAs can also help you schedule meetings and appointments with clients, vendors, and other business contacts. They can handle all of the back-and-forth emailing and phone calls to find a time that works for everyone involved. And if you need to travel for a meeting or event, your VA can take care of all of the details—from booking flights and hotels to creating a detailed itinerary.

Manage Your Contacts

A VA can also help you stay on top of your business contacts by keeping an updated contact list. This way, you’ll always have the most up-to-date information—like phone numbers, email addresses, and mailing addresses—for all of your clients, vendors, suppliers, and others. Plus, if you ever need to get in touch with someone in a hurry, your VA will be able to track them down for you quickly and easily.
